Steps for Optimizing USDT Handling Fees
1. Understand USDT and Its FeesUSDT (Tether) is a stablecoin pegged to the value of the US dollar, designed to provide stability and affordability in cryptocurrency transactions. USDT fees are typically charged for transactions involving USDT, including deposits, withdrawals, and trading. The fee structure varies across different exchanges and platforms.
2. Choosing the Right Exchange or PlatformSelecting the most suitable platform for USDT handling is crucial to minimize fees. Factors to consider include trading fees, withdrawal fees, payment methods supported, customer support availability, and security measures employed.
3. Optimizing USDT Fees- Using OTC Platforms: Over-the-counter (OTC) platforms offer competitive fee rates for large-volume USDT transactions.
- Negotiating with Exchanges: Investors with significant trading volumes may negotiate with exchanges to lower their USDT fees.
- Utilizing Stablecoins with Lower Fees: Consider using stablecoins with lower transaction fees, such as BUSD or USDC, for certain transactions.
- Bundling Transactions: Group multiple USDT transactions together to reduce the overall fee impact.
- Using Fee Waiving Services: Some platforms may offer fee waivers or discounts for specific trading volumes or membership levels.
- Monitor Exchange Fees Regularly: Stay updated on the fee structures of the exchanges or platforms used for USDT handling.
- Review Transaction History: Regularly assess recent USDT transactions to identify patterns and optimize fees.
- Use Fee Tracking Tools: Utilize third-party software or platforms that help track and manage USDT fees across multiple accounts or exchanges.
FAQs on USDT Handling Fees
What is the average USDT handling fee?USDT handling fees vary widely depending on the exchange or platform used. Generally, fees range from 0.1% to 3% per transaction.
What factors influence USDT handling fees?Factors that impact USDT handling fees include transaction size, payment method, exchange fees, and network congestion.
How can I minimize USDT handling fees?Choosing the right platform, using OTC platforms, and utilizing fee optimization strategies can help reduce USDT handling fees.
What are some common USDT handling fee strategies?Common strategies include using OTC platforms, negotiating with exchanges, and using stablecoins with lower fees.
How can I track USDT handling fees?Monitoring exchange fees, reviewing transaction history, and using fee tracking tools help manage and track USDT handling fees effectively.
